EU Cookie Wall

Description

This plugin add’s a simple cookie wall to comply with Dutch Cookie-laws. This plugin can be used when there is not ‘light’ version available of the website without cookies and 3rd-party embeds.

Features

  • Bot/indexer/SEO friendly, only target the users you want to target.
  • Customise the look and feel
  • Easily change the content of the cookie wall
  • Easy control with shortcodes

Installation

  1. Upload the plugin files to the /wp-content/plugins/cookie-wall directory, or install the plugin through the WordPress plugins screen directly.
  2. Activate the plugin through the ‘Plugins’ screen in WordPress
  3. Create a page with the desired cookie notice text. And save the ID for step 4.
  4. Use the Settings->Cookie Wall screen to configure the plugin

What about Google?

This plugin targets only a browser by user-agent most of the spiders, indexers and bots (like WhatsApp/telegram previews, Facebook share preview, etc.) are not redirected to the cookie wall. This way they can index what they want without interruption.
